We stayed in this amazing villa and aptly named 'Maison Des Reves' ('House of Dreams') for a two-week holiday. The house and the grounds are incredible and are completely private. You can go for a nice long walk in the grounds, there is so much space. The swimming pool area is a suntrap with incredible views of the surrounding countryside. We had the most relaxing holiday that we have had in years. St Alvere is a quaint and typically French village and the people are very friendly. The weekly market is certainly worth a visit and you should try out each boulangerie for all the different tasting bread. The homegrown vegetable shop is the place to go for fresh fruit and veg. The restaurants in the village are worth a visit. St. Alvere is an ideal location for touring the Dordogne region. We would recommend a car to get around and there is plenty to do e.g. Chateaux’s, Vineyard visits, the Aquarium, Prehistoric Caves, tennis, cycling, foie grais farm visits and so much more. We would recommend this villa to anyone looking for some rest and relaxation and it’s suitable for all holiday makers including couples, groups and families with children etc. We came home rejuvenated and we will definitely be back!
